The title "Mamath Gahaniyak" translates directly to "I am also a woman." This phrasing sets the tone for a deeply emotional narrative revolving around a female protagonist fighting for her dignity, identity, and survival in a hostile environment. This information is officially cataloged by , the

The era that birthed Mamath Gahaniyak is widely studied in contemporary Sri Lankan film history. Sandwiched between the golden artistic era of the 1970s–1980s and the modern independent cinema revival of the 2010s, the early 2000s represented a desperate survival phase for local theaters.
